Abstract

The parameters affecting the reliability of threaded joints are analyzed. The most significant is the tightening force. Existing methods of improving the assembly and disassembly of threaded joints by means of ultrasound are reviewed. The most significant parameter is found to be the vibrational amplitude of the ultrasound. The influence of shear vibrations on the forces within the joint is investigated.
